Output 17ef32bf834fcc180103fdc5db7bd3291fd9cd28e9fb9e699c5b232c653e1e46:0

value
148861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d370e27487c474035459e4f9734b71abebb1dd15 OP_EQUAL
address
3Ly1jNveCwf2uefZpYHKYio6Z5yWAe4LXv
transaction
17ef32bf834fcc180103fdc5db7bd3291fd9cd28e9fb9e699c5b232c653e1e46
confirmations
88416
spent
true